Ha, reminds me of a service call several year ago.
Put a new line in for a horsey gal. Drain back curb stop, new waterer, 20x20 pad,she
Spared no expense.
She called a several months later reading me the riot act. Water bill was outragous, pipe was leaking,
mud hole forming next to the concrete. To top it off, water was leaking through the wall in the basement.
After a little investigation, turns out she only had the valve open half way. Allowed the curb stop
to spew water under pressure for months.

She thought it only need to be open a little.........she only had one horse!
